SetPlayerPos

  • Command

Teleports your character to specified X, Y, Z coordinates; requires cheats enabled.

Syntax

Console syntax

cheat SetPlayerPos <X> <Y> <Z>

Arguments

x type: number
The X coordinate to teleport to.
y type: number
The Y coordinate to teleport to.
z type: number
The Z coordinate to teleport to.

About

SetPlayerPos moves your player character to any location on the map by coordinate. You must be in single-player, have cheats enabled, or be an admin on a multiplayer server to use it.

Enter three numbers for the X, Y, and Z axes. Coordinates are measured from the center of the map in the direction indicated; check your HUD or use another admin tool to find the target location's numbers first. The command executes immediately and doesn't require you to be standing in any particular spot.

This is faster than flying or walking for testing spawns, trapped players, or map knowledge, but it bypasses all movement and physics, you'll land exactly where you specify, even midair or inside geometry.

How do I enable admin commands to run SetPlayerPos?
In single-player, cheats are on by default. On a dedicated or hosted server, log in as admin with enablecheats <AdminPassword> first, then run cheat SetPlayerPos <X> <Y> <Z>. Without admin access the console rejects it.

Can I run the SetPlayerPos command over RCON?
Yes. Send cheat SetPlayerPos <X> <Y> <Z> through RCON or your control-panel console. If the connection already runs with admin context, omit the leading "cheat". It works the same on hosted, self-hosted, and RCON setups.
